the IC's come as a pack of 5 from RS at 1.48 ea (you would only need 2), the LEDs price depends on what you want, 10p-10quid range (each) (I'd advise 70p each for nice bright clear lens LEDs), resistors are pennies, stereo jacks are bout a pound each, How do you want it presented, led's on flyleads so you can put them anywhere? the entire thing built into a box? or bay blank?
